以下是一个使用PHP代码画一个圆的简单示例。这个例子使用了``标签来显示使用PHP GD库绘制的圆形图像。
```php

// 创建一个图像资源
$image = imagecreatetruecolor(200, 200);
// 分配颜色
$white = imagecolorallocate($image, 255, 255, 255);
$black = imagecolorallocate($image, 0, 0, 0);
// 填充背景颜色
imagefill($image, 0, 0, $white);
// 绘制圆形
imagefilledellipse($image, 100, 100, 180, 180, $black);
// 输出图像到浏览器
header('Content-Type: image/png');
imagepng($image);
// 释放内存
imagedestroy($image);
>
```
以下是一个表格,列出了代码中使用的函数和它们的作用:
| 函数 | 作用 |
|---|---|
| `imagecreatetruecolor()` | 创建一个真彩色的图像资源,参数为图像宽度和高度 |
| `imagecolorallocate()` | 分配颜色,参数为图像资源、红色、绿色、蓝色 |
| `imagefill()` | 用指定的颜色填充图像的一部分,参数为图像资源、x坐标、y坐标、宽度、高度、颜色 |
| `imagefilledellipse()` | 绘制一个实心椭圆,参数为图像资源、x坐标、y坐标、半长轴、半短轴、颜色 |
| `header()` | 发送原始的HTTP头信息 |
| `imagepng()` | 输出图像为PNG格式 |
| `imagedestroy()` | 释放图像资源,避免内存泄漏 |
这个PHP代码将创建一个200x200像素的图像,其中包含一个实心圆形。通过将此代码保存为`.php`文件并在支持PHP的服务器上运行,您可以在浏览器中看到结果。







